			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div align="center"><strong>Natalie Wood: A Tribute</strong></div>
<p align="center"><em><strong>By Dina-Marie Kulzer</strong></em></p>
<p align="center">
<p><em><strong><img height="425" alt="Natalie Wood in the early 1960s" src="http://www.classichollywoodbios.com/Images/Natalie%20Wood%20Images/N.%20Wood%20Early%2060s.jpg" width="339" align="left" /></strong></em>Although she began her career as a child actress, Natalie Wood was never what you could call a &#8220;child star&#8221;. There was no hint of the cutesy mannerisms of some of her contemporaries, but instead a sense of seriousness and intelligence beyond her years in her performances. She radiated warmth and grace in every scene. This was particularly evident when she played a war orphan refugee complete with a German accent opposite Orson Welles and Claudette Colbert in <em>Tomorrow Is Forever</em> at the age of six. Her soft brown eyes reflected every emotion she conveyed on screen. Natalie was one of the few child stars that was able to make a successful transition into adult roles with no awkward period in between. Her explanation of this was: &#8220;I just went on working. I was always skinny and as I got older I could still play young girls and get by. I was never a child star like Shirley Temple. I always looked like an ordinary kid.&#8221; Natalie&#8217;s talent was far from ordinary. Orson Welles once said of his little co-star, &#8220;She was so good, she frightened me.&#8221;</p>
<p>Natalie Wood was born Natasha Nikoleavean Gurdin on July 20, 1938 in San Francisco, California. She was the child of Russian immigrants Nicholas and Maria Zaharenko (later changed to Gurdin), the middle daughter between older sister Olga and younger sister Lana. Natalie made her film debut at the tender age of four. Unable to read yet, her sister Olga would read the lines to her and Natalie would memorize them. Her incredible career spanned almost 40 years.</p>

<p>Perhaps her most memorable childhood role was that of &#8220;Susan&#8221;, the little girl too sensible to believe in Santa Claus in <em>Miracle on 34th Street </em>(1947). That particular film is a holiday classic. It did, in fact, run on television in Los Angeles on the day of her untimely death. The flickering image of that talented, wise beyond her years child, was heartbreaking to watch.</p>
<p>The turning point in Natalie&#8217;s career from child to more mature roles came in 1955 when she co-starred with James Dean and Sal Mineo in <em>Rebel Without a Cause</em>. Natalie received the first of three Oscar nominations for that film. The other two were for her stirring performances in <em>Splendor in the Grass</em> (1961) and <em>Love With the Proper Stranger</em> (1963). Natalie once described the effect <em>Rebel Without a Cause</em> and James Dean had on her career: &#8220;It was the first time I had any feelings about a role. Up to then I had just worked without questions. James taught me to relax before playing tense. I had never thought of acting that way before.&#8221; In the film <em>Marjorie Morningstar</em> (1958), radiant Natalie again displayed her blossoming dramatic talent.</p>
<p align="center"><img height="302" alt="Natalie Wood, James Dean, Rebel Without a Case 1955" src="http://www.classichollywoodbios.com/Images/Natalie%20Wood%20Images/N.%20Wood%20Rebel%20Without%20A%20Cause%20%281955%29.jpg" width="370" /></p>
<p align="center"><strong>James Dean &amp; Natalie Wood in <em>Rebel Without a Cause</em> (1955)</strong></p>
<p>The love story of Natalie Wood and Robert Wagner is a unique and moving one. Ten year old Natalie fell in love at first sight with the handsome, enthusiastic young actor when she saw him walking down the hall at 20th Century Fox. She turned to her mother and declared &#8220;I&#8217;m going to marry him&#8221; and she did just that, twice.</p>
<p>They married the first time in 1957 when Natalie was only 19 years old. The Wagners were easily the most stunning Hollywood couple since Gable and Lombard. They divorced in 1962, blaming the end of this first marriage on mutual immaturity and career conflicts.</p>

<p align="left"><img height="391" alt="Natalie Wood in The Great Race 1965" src="http://www.classichollywoodbios.com/Images/Natalie%20Wood%20Images/The%20Great%20Race.jpg" width="270" align="left" />The sixties were perhaps Natalie&#8217;s most productive decade, professionally if not personally. She gave some sterling performances in classic films that reflected the times in which they were made. <em>West Side Story</em> (1961) dealt with racial prejudice, <em>Inside Daisy Clover</em> (1966) with the harsh side of stardom behind the glamour and <em>Bob &amp; Carol &amp; Ted &amp; Alice</em> (1969) had Natalie as a middle class housewife trying to cope with the new morality. Other notable films Natalie made in the sixties were the musical <em>Gypsy</em> (1962) as stripper <em>Gypsy Rose Lee </em>and <em>The Great Race</em> a comedy with Jack Lemmon and Tony Curtis (1965).</p>
<p>In 1969 Natalie married British producer Richard Gregson. Their short lived marriage produced one daughter, Natasha born in 1970 who is today an actress and the mirror image of her mother. Natalie divorced Gregson in 1971.</p>
<p align="left">During her separation from Gregson, Natalie began to date Robert Wagner again. They re-discovered how much they loved and meant to each other. The Wagners re-married in 1972 aboard their yacht. Each having gone through analysis between their marriages, they approached this second marriage with new maturity and understanding. Natalie recalled: &#8220;When R.J. and I met ten years later, after our divorce, we were different people. It wasn&#8217;t like going back to what we had before because we had both changed. We were still attracted to one another &#8211;there&#8217;s always something about that first love. It was like getting to know a whole new person although somewhere in the back of your mind &#8211;you already knew them.&#8221;</p>

<p>Natalie happily semi-retired to devote more time to her family, which had a new addition Courtney Brooke Wagner born in 1974. Concerning her screen hiatus and motherhood Natalie once said: &#8220;I love acting and I know I could have been working all the time. There was a period in my life where I just went from picture to picture. I really didn&#8217;t have any other life. I felt rather empty and I guess I was. You must be able to give something back in life. I&#8217;ve discovered being a mother puts things in wonderful perspective, I&#8217;m so happy that I&#8217;m terrified! You can be working on a set where everything seems a matter of life and death, when suddenly you get a phone call that one of your kids has come down with a fever. All at once that becomes much more important than some movie where an actor is throwing a tantrum on the set.&#8221;</p>
<p><strong>Robert Wagner &amp; Natalie Wood in the late 1970s</strong></p>
<p align="left"><img height="321" alt="Robert Wagner, Natalie Wood in the late 1970s" src="http://www.classichollywoodbios.com/Images/Natalie%20Wood%20Images/Wood%20&amp;%20Wagner.jpg" width="240" align="left" />Natalie believed that people who drew a line of distinction between films and television were snobbish, that good work was good work no matter what medium it was performed for. In the later years of her career Natalie gave some exceptional performances for television in <em>Cat on a Hot Tin Roof</em> (1976) with husband Robert Wagner and Sir Laurence Oliver whom she greatly admired. Also, the mini series <em>From Here to Eternity</em> and the film <em>The Cracker Factory</em> both in 1979.</p>
<p>Natalie Wood would often say in interviews throughout her life, &#8220;I like being on the water or near the water but not in the water.&#8221; In many of her films she was required to film scenes in the water despite her objections. Bette Davis came to her defense in <em>The Star</em> (1952) when director Stuart Heisler insisted Natalie to jump into the ocean and swim to a raft. He would not listen to Natalie&#8217;s fears and Natalie recalled Bette Davis&#8217;s threat to leave the film unless a double was used. In 1977 at the American Film Institute tribute to the actress, Natalie recalled &#8220;This was the only time I saw the famous Bette Davis temperament surface&#8211; and it was not in her own behalf.&#8221;</p>
<p>Ironically, it was an accidental drowning that brought premature death to Natalie Wood on Thanksgiving weekend 1981 at the age of forty three, off the coast of Santa Catalina Island while aboard the Wagner&#8217;s yacht &#8220;The Splendour&#8221;, in the dark waters she was terrified of since childhood</p>
<p>The following Wednesday afternoon at Westwood Memorial Park author Thomas Thompson reassured those gathered to say their last farewell to Natalie Wood Wagner, as the Russian string instruments reminiscent of her heritage played softly in the back ground, &#8220;What a fabulous life she had!&#8221; and what a great lady she was.</p>

<p>Yep, PEZ sez&#8217; SEX.<br />
We all know that sex &#8220;sells&#8221;, and this is not a new concept. Companies have been using sexy models and themes to sell their product for a very long time. And this business marketing concept was not lost on Edward Haas, as well. Although we think of colorful and witty character heads when we think of PEZ&#8230; Haas&#8217;s candy creation was specifically made and sold for an adult market until the 60&#8242;s. To sell to adults, PEZ and its marketing team used sex to help sell their product.</p>
<p>In his efforts to discover a new flavor for candy, Haas came across oil of peppermint. He knew that this oil could be turned into a new flavorful candy, and set out to make this happen. In that day, oil of peppermint could only be purchased through chemists, but this did not deter Haas. He formulated a new candy using this oil, and it became an instant hit. The rich flavor of the peppermint was considered to be a luxury item. Haas&#8217;s market audience would be adults and smokers… with Haas especially targeting the smokers. Haas believed that peppermint candy could be used as a method to get people to quit smoking and to freshen their breath. After overcoming several obstacles (chemists of that day were not happy about having a substance that only they could provide turned into a candy that could be purchased by the general public), Haas started selling his new candy.</p>
<p>Knowing that beautiful women could best sell to the adult market, Haas created the PEZgirls. Haas hired young and beautiful girls to sell his product. They were dressed in stylish trousers and grey jackets and attracted a lot of attention.</p>
<p>Before the 1950&#8242;s, PEZ relied on the PEZgirls, print advertising, and signage to help sell their product.</p>
<p>In this magazine ad, PEZ used a beautiful model to help sell its product. At this time, PEZ was still considered a &#8220;luxury&#8221; candy, and this ad definitely has a classy, refined, &#8220;high society&#8221; feel to it. In the body of this ad it reads… &#8220;[PEZ] is the luxury of the distinguished world, it animates the palate, gives to pure breath and is wonderfully aromatic&#8221;.</p>

<p align="left">In the years before the 1950&#8242;s, PEZ commissioned many artists to create graphics for their print advertising and signage. One of the more familiar graphics for the PEZgirl was created by Manasee. In this picture on the right is Manasee&#8217;s PEZgirl graphic as shown on a 1990&#8242;s telephone calling card cover.</p>
<p align="left">Manasee embedded some subtle hints of sexiness in his artwork. Remember that these were done in a time where the level of sexual innuendo and nudity, as we now are accustomed to, would not have been allowed. But yet, there was a certain sexy feel to this graphic, with the PEZgirl having big, dark, beautiful eyes and a full, playful smile. I&#8217;m certain that this <img src="http://img225.imageshack.us/img225/6392/phone2tp3.jpg" /> graphic was an eye catcher in this era.</p>
<p><img src="http://img225.imageshack.us/img225/6940/pg1cc5.jpg" /><br />
The 1950&#8242;s ushered in the &#8220;Golden&#8221; age for PEZ. Up until the late 1940&#8242;s, PEZ was carried around in small pocket tins. Haas&#8217;s determination to make PEZ an alternative to smoking, led PEZ to design a dispenser that would make it just as stylish to whip out and eat a PEZ candy as it was to pull out a lighter to light a cigarette. In 1948, PEZ came out with such a dispenser that would be an &#8220;easy, hygienic&#8221; way to dispense PEZ… and this dispenser is now what we call a &#8220;Regular&#8221;.</p>
<p>The post World War II environment of the 1950&#8242;s saw a resurgence of sex being used as a marketing device in advertising. &#8220;Girlie&#8221; Pin-Up artists like Gillette Elvgren and Alberto Vargas, who began their pin-up art careers in the 1940&#8242;s, flourished. Their artwork soon became staples for print ads.</p>
<p>During this era, PEZ pushed ahead with targeting an adult audience for their product. The PEZgirl got a new image with the grey jacket of years gone by replaced by a royal blue jacket, signifying a change in the world&#8217;s attitude for the new prosperous times. The PEZgirl was to be found everywhere, and she had a new sexy look.</p>
<p align="left">&nbsp;</p>
<p align="left">In <img src="http://img46.imageshack.us/img46/4016/pg2yj3.jpg" /> this picture is the 1950&#8242;s PEZgirl carrying a tray of PEZ candy. It was common during this time for beautiful girls to sell product in this manner in clubs and other public venues.</p>
<p>It was in the 1950&#8242;s that PEZ hired a new graphic artist to render the PEZgirl for their print ads. This artist was Gerhard Brause, and to many is considered to be the main reason why PEZ became so successful. It wasn&#8217;t the candy or the dispensers that caught people&#8217;s eyes, it was Brause&#8217;s artwork of the PEZgirl. Prior to joining PEZ, Brause worked for the Palmers Company… a leading manufacturer of women&#8217;s lingerie and stockings. It was with Palmers that Brause became famous as a graphic artist.</p>

<p>These are two examples of artwork done by Brause for Palmers advertising. His paintings were of high heeled women with silk stockings, and were very sexy. At one point in his career with Palmers, Brause created a piece of advertising artwork that was too sexy for that time, and it was censored. This &#8220;scandal&#8221; gave Brause a level of notoriety and he became famous overnight.</p>
<p><img src="http://img207.imageshack.us/img207/8128/brausegirl1wd9.jpg" /><br />
Brause&#8217;s paintings of the PEZgirl were full of life, with a more expressive and sexually charged theme than earlier artists like Manasee. Johann Patek describes Brause as being &#8220;The Michelangelo of the 50&#8242;s&#8221;. Brause created his artwork from mostly his own mental imagery. He rarely used models, but when he did, it was primarily to have fun with them.</p>
<p>This picture shows Brause&#8217;s famous image of the PEZgirl, and is often referred to (in the European art world) as being his &#8220;Mona Lisa in enamel&#8221;.<br />
<img src="http://img207.imageshack.us/img207/3395/brausegirl2uj7.jpg" /></p>
<p align="left">Brause also created this famous graphic of the PEZgirl sitting on a pack of peppermint candy. You can easily see the influence from his previous work with Palmers in this painting. The PEZgirl has long, shapely legs wearing stockings and high heeled shoes, with her skirt seductively pushed back off of her legs. This is the only graphic of the PEZgirl that shows her below the waist. Haas, although directing the use of hidden sex in their advertising, felt that this graphic was a bit too sexy for the PEZgirl, and would take attention away from the actual product. From this point on, the PEZgirl would only be pictured from the waist up.</p>
<p align="left">Yep&#8230; the PEZgirl was SEXY! She definitely had a *Pin Up* style that was all her own.</p>
<p align="left">Brause continued working for PEZ until the late 1970&#8242;s. Although not widely known, Brause was also an accomplished sculptor, and PEZ took advantage of these skills as well. Brause created many of the older dispenser heads, including the following: Betsy Ross, Indian Maiden, Duck with Flower, Roar the Lion, the Circus Elephants, and the Make-A-Face dispenser.</p>
<p align="left">His artwork had a very particular flair and was unmistakable. After his departure, there was a definite change in the appearance of PEZ advertising. Brause&#8217;s contributions to PEZ&#8217;s success is nicely summed up by Johann Patek… &#8220;Generally speaking, the whole success of PEZ was responsible largely on the untamed soul and talent of Gerhard Brause plus a free acting team of young guys in the PEZ management, who could spread their unrestricted seeds on a hungry post war ground. It was not the product, it was the way it was advertised and later how it was sold (namely with a character dispenser)&#8221;.</p>

<p align="left">This ad came out in July of 1955. Although the girl in the ad is fully clothed, she is shown as being well endowed, with her full breasts straining against a tight and well-fitting blouse. She has a sexy smile and PEZ&#8217;s trademark dark and sultry eyes. She is energetically reaching for a piece of candy out of a Golden Glow regular, that is being held in an obviously well-to-do male&#8217;s hand (notice the well groomed fingernails). This ad clearly implies &#8220;Gentlemen know that PEZ attracts beautiful women&#8221;. The product and its message is specifically targeted at adult consumers, and has a very sexy feel to it.</p>

If you are targeting an adult market for your product, where would you place your ads? How about in a magazine that is sold to men! In the 1950&#8242;s and 1960&#8242;s, PEZ was a regular advertiser in a popular German men&#8217;s *girlie* magazine called &#8220;Wiener Magazin&#8221;, as shown below. This magazine featured a photo of a girl on the front cover, like Playboy, and often had either a PEZ ad on the back cover or a full page PEZ ad on the inside.</p>

<p>The 1960&#8242;s brought us a whole new attitude in the world. With it, the PEZgirl was changed and updated into a more *MOD* icon for PEZ. Her hairstyle changed, and her PEZ jacket started sporting a new plunging V-neckline. Like her sisters before, the PEZgirl remained on the leading edge of fashion and sexiness.</p>
<p>This picture shows the 1960&#8242;s PEZgirl at work&#8230; looking great&#8230; pushing PEZ.</p>
<p><img src="http://img177.imageshack.us/img177/3048/pg3po3.jpg" /><br />
The 1970&#8242;s PEZgirl erupted onto the scene with The-Girl-Next-Door beauty and sexiness. In this PEZ Company photograph, you can see how the PEZgirl&#8217;s looks had changed to match with the times. Long, wavy, Farah Fawcet hair was all the rage&#8230; and the PEZgirl pioneered this style.<br />
